php session_id用法,请指点。~
本帖最后由 eiysxd 于 2014-08-10 17:23:40 编辑
看到osc上的一个问题。
问题如下本2文来*源gao($daima.com搞@代@#码(网搞gaodaima代码:
请问一个问题, Cookies可以记录用户名和密码来实现自动登录网站.思路是用户登录的时候用js获取数据,生成cookies文件保存在用户的计算机里面,下次登录的时候自动读取是否存在Cookies文件,有就加载登录它.
请问这个用户名和密码如何加密保存? 难道只是普通的用户名和加密的密码吗?
有一个用户回答:
别逗了,怎么能够把密码保存到客户端的cookie里呢,自动登录是将session id保存到cookie里实现的
请问如何利用php的session_id来实现生成唯一值?,原理应该是 用户登录了网站,就把该用户的这个session_Id写入数据库的一列,然后也写入到cookies,当用户再次打开网站的时候会有一个功能 就是检索用户是否有该网站的cookies,然后读取,与数据库验证,返回用户的登录状态。
但是session_id到底要怎么用? 要如何实现唯一值 ,?请指点。
——解决方案——————–
服務器生成的唯一值,只要是同一會話且沒有過期,獲取到的session_id()是一樣的。
<br /><?php<br />session_start();<br />echo session_id();<br />?><br />
每次都一樣,除非關閉了瀏覽器再開才會再生成。
搞代码网(gaodaima.com)提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请说明详细缘由并提供版权或权益证明然后发送到邮箱[email protected],我们会在看到邮件的第一时间内为您处理,或直接联系QQ:872152909。本网站采用BY-NC-SA协议进行授权
转载请注明原文链接:php session_id用法,请指导。
转载请注明原文链接:php session_id用法,请指导。
